For questions on expansion: 
_____ gains thermal energy from the _____ by _______. As the atoms at that end gain thermal energy, they move faster (increase in kinetic energy) and move further away from each other. 

For questions on transfer of heat from one end of the object to the other end: _____ gains thermal energy from  _____ by _______. As the atoms at the hotter end gain thermal energy, some of the thermal energy is converted to kinetic energy. The atoms vibrate faster and collide with neighbouring atoms and transfer the thermal energy to them. This process is repeated, allowing thermal energy to be transferred from one end of the object to the other. 
Answering Technique for Radiation: Usage of black paint coating instead of other colours 
_____ is a good absorber/emitter of thermal energy transmitted by radiation._____ will absorb/emit more thermal radiation than _____.Therefore, the _____ will gain/lose thermal energy faster, causing the _____ to become hotter/cooler than _____. 

Note: if the question is on radiation, do not use the word “conductor”. Use “absorber” or “emitter” instead
